Basic Baking lesson 2
Yesterday was the 2nd lesson for the basic baking class for 2010. I run this class at Palate Sensations, 4 times a year. I did not take any photos of the 1st basic baking class, as that was the busiest class. All the students are new to me and also some are new to baking. The 1st class was all female. We actually had a good time although we were rushing for time.
The 2nd class was also a busy class, with 4 quick cakes to bake. I thought I will give them a kick start by melting the chocolate and butter for the brownies in advance. Everyone came early and was very excited to get. Menu for the class is Brownies, Raspberry and white chocolate muffins, Banana cake and Marble Cake. 4 cakes, 13 students and 2 ovens, is it possible to finish in 3 hours? Well, we did it. Here are some of the photos from the class. Enjoy.
Getting ready, measureing out the ingredients and working as a team.

Sunday, January 17, 2010
Introduction
Hi all,
I have just graduated from Le Cordon Bleu Sydney, sometime July 2009, in both Cuisine and Pastry. After which, I hae come back to Singapore and work for a restaurant as a pastry chef for 2 mths and proceed to teach at Palate Sensations as a pastry chef. Some of you may have read my previous blog http://chefangy.blogspot.com/, where I blog about my life in LCB.
This blog is more of NOW. What I will be doing now and in the future. I will feature blogs of my classes, food that I made and also places I have dined in. Please stay tune for more. And please feel free to give your comments. :P Happy New Year!
